Strategic Integration for Maximum Impact
Simply inserting a beautiful graphic isn't enough. To truly benefit from a premium design asset like this, you need to integrate it thoughtfully into your broader design assets and brand identity. How you use it will influence everything from visual hierarchy to audience perception.
Consider your font pairing. The illustrative, often delicate nature of these graphics pairs best with typefaces that complement rather than compete. A clean, modern sans serif font for body text can provide excellent readability against an intricate floral border. For headlines, a elegant script font or a refined serif font can mirror the romanticism of the illustrations. Avoid overly busy or decorative fonts that would create visual clutter. The goal is harmony, where the typography and the graphics support each other to guide the viewer's eye and reinforce the message.
Think about visual hierarchy. Use a larger, more detailed graphic like the couple in the garden as a hero image on a landing page. Use smaller elements, like the lovebirds or a single floral sprig, as supporting icons in a list or as decorative bullets. This creates a rhythm and prevents the design from feeling overwhelming. For social media graphics, these assets are gold. They can instantly elevate a simple quote card or a promotional announcement, making it more shareable and emotionally engaging. The consistency of using the same collection across a campaign builds a recognizable visual thread, strengthening brand perception and professionalism.
Making the Right Choice for Your Project
Before you commit, it's wise to evaluate if Weddingvectors - 22005090 is the right fit. Start by downloading any available previews. Place the graphics into your actual project mockup. Does the style align with your brand's existing voice? Is the level of detail appropriate for your intended use? A highly detailed floral might be stunning on a printed invitation but could become a muddy blob when scaled down for a favicon.
Test font pairings early. Try out a few of your preferred creative fonts alongside the graphics to see what creates the most pleasing and readable composition. Review all the included styles and extras. The value of the set often lies in its variety—the main scenes plus the supporting icons and borders. Finally, always confirm the commercial font licensing. Ensure the license covers your specific use case, whether it's for client work, products for sale, or digital advertisements. A high-quality typeface or graphic set is an investment, and understanding its terms ensures you can use it with confidence and integrity.
